音頻播放是網頁中常見的功能之一,可以為網站增加更多的娛樂性和互動性。本文將詳細介紹音頻播放的HTML實現代碼,幫助讀者快速掌握音頻播放的實現方法。
1. HTML5 audio標簽
HTML5新增了一個audio標簽,可以直接在網頁中播放音頻文件。使用方法如下:audio src="音頻文件路徑"></audio>
其中,src屬性指定要播放的音頻文件路徑,可以是相對路徑或絕對路徑。如果需要自動播放,可以添加autoplay屬性;如果需要循環播放,可以添加loop屬性。
2. 控制音頻播放
在實際應用中,我們需要對音頻進行控制,比如播放、暫停、停止、調整音量等。可以通過JavaScript來實現控制功能。下面是一些常用的控制方法:
// 獲取audio標簽ententsByTagName("audio")[0];
// 播放
audio.play();
// 暫停
audio.pause();
// 停止tTime = 0;
audio.pause();
// 調整音量e = 0.5; // 0到1之間的值
3. 監聽音頻事件
在播放音頻的過程中,我們需要監聽一些事件,比如播放結束、播放進度、音量變化等。可以通過JavaScript來監聽這些事件,下面是一些常用的事件:
// 播放結束tListenerdedction() {sole.log("播放結束");
// 播放進度tListenereupdatection() {soletTime);
// 音量變化tListenerechangection() {solee);
4. 兼容性問題
在使用HTML5 audio標簽時,需要注意兼容性問題。不同瀏覽器對音頻格式的支持不同,有些瀏覽器不支持某些格式的音頻文件。為了兼容不同瀏覽器,可以使用多個格式的音頻文件,然后在HTML中使用source標簽來指定不同格式的音頻文件路徑,瀏覽器會自動選擇支持的格式進行播放。audio>p3peg">source src="音頻文件路徑.ogg" type="audio/ogg">/audio>
本文介紹了音頻播放的HTML實現代碼,包括使用HTML5 audio標簽、控制音頻播放、監聽音頻事件和兼容性問題。讀者可以根據實際需求選擇不同的實現方式,增加網站的娛樂性和互動性。